Missing Illinois teen, newborn found unharmed

CHARLESTON, W.Va. (AP) — An Illinois man accused of kidnapping his 13-year-old step-daughter and her 3-week-old baby has been arrested at a makeshift campsite in West Virginia.

Kanawha County Sheriff's Office Sgt. Brian Humphreys tells The Charleston Gazette-Mail someone called in a tip that Christopher Ray Delerth had been spotted in the Cabin Creek area. Delerth was arrested around 1:30 p.m. Saturday, Sept. 24. He will be returned to Madison County, Illinois, where he faces kidnapping charges.

Delerth's step-daughter and her son were transported to a local hospital to be examined. Humphreys says they both appeared to be fine.

Authorities in Illinois have said the teenager has a congenital heart defect and a pacemaker. Delerth had previously been ordered not to contact her.

Humphreys did not know if Delerth had an attorney.
